import Foundation
import UIKit
import AsyncDisplayKit
import TelegramPresentationData
import AccountContext
import Display
import Postbox
import TelegramCore
import SwiftSignalKit
final class PeerInfoHeaderEditingContentNode: ASDisplayNode {
private let context: AccountContext
private let requestUpdateLayout: () -> Void
var requestEditing: (() -> Void)?
let avatarNode: PeerInfoEditingAvatarNode
let avatarTextNode: ImmediateTextNode
let avatarButtonNode: HighlightableButtonNode
var itemNodes: [PeerInfoHeaderTextFieldNodeKey: PeerInfoHeaderTextFieldNode] = [:]
init(context: AccountContext, requestUpdateLayout: @escaping () -> Void) {
self.context = context
self.requestUpdateLayout = requestUpdateLayout
self.avatarNode = PeerInfoEditingAvatarNode(context: context)
self.avatarTextNode = ImmediateTextNode()
self.avatarButtonNode = HighlightableButtonNode()
super.init()
self.addSubnode(self.avatarNode)
self.avatarButtonNode.addSubnode(self.avatarTextNode)
self.avatarButtonNode.addTarget(self, action: #selector(textPressed), forControlEvents: .touchUpInside)
}
@objc private func textPressed() {
self.requestEditing?()
}
func editingTextForKey(_ key: PeerInfoHeaderTextFieldNodeKey) -> String? {
return self.itemNodes[key]?.text
}
func shakeTextForKey(_ key: PeerInfoHeaderTextFieldNodeKey) {
self.itemNodes[key]?.layer.addShakeAnimation()
}
func update(width: CGFloat, safeInset: CGFloat, statusBarHeight: CGFloat, navigationHeight: CGFloat, isModalOverlay: Bool, peer: EnginePeer?, threadData: MessageHistoryThreadData?, chatLocation: ChatLocation, cachedData: CachedPeerData?, isContact: Bool, isSettings: Bool, presentationData: PresentationData, transition: ContainedViewLayoutTransition) -> CGFloat {
let avatarSize: CGFloat = isModalOverlay ? 200.0 : 100.0
let avatarFrame = CGRect(origin: CGPoint(x: floor((width - avatarSize) / 2.0), y: statusBarHeight + 22.0), size: CGSize(width: avatarSize, height: avatarSize))
transition.updateFrameAdditiveToCenter(node: self.avatarNode, frame: CGRect(origin: avatarFrame.center, size: CGSize()))
var contentHeight: CGFloat = statusBarHeight + 10.0 + avatarSize + 28.0
if canEditPeerInfo(context: self.context, peer: peer, chatLocation: chatLocation, threadData: threadData) {
if self.avatarButtonNode.supernode == nil {
self.addSubnode(self.avatarButtonNode)
}
self.avatarTextNode.attributedText = NSAttributedString(string: presentationData.strings.Settings_SetNewProfilePhotoOrVideo, font: Font.regular(17.0), textColor: presentationData.theme.list.itemAccentColor)
self.avatarButtonNode.accessibilityLabel = self.avatarTextNode.attributedText?.string
let avatarTextSize = self.avatarTextNode.updateLayout(CGSize(width: width, height: 32.0))
transition.updateFrame(node: self.avatarTextNode, frame: CGRect(origin: CGPoint(), size: avatarTextSize))
transition.updateFrame(node: self.avatarButtonNode, frame: CGRect(origin: CGPoint(x: floorToScreenPixels((width - avatarTextSize.width) / 2.0), y: contentHeight - 5.0), size: avatarTextSize))
contentHeight += 32.0
}
var isEditableBot = false
if case let .user(user) = peer, let botInfo = user.botInfo, botInfo.flags.contains(.canEdit) {
isEditableBot = true
}
var fieldKeys: [PeerInfoHeaderTextFieldNodeKey] = []
if case let .user(user) = peer {
if !user.isDeleted {
fieldKeys.append(.firstName)
if isEditableBot {
fieldKeys.append(.description)
} else if user.botInfo == nil {
fieldKeys.append(.lastName)
}
}
} else if case .legacyGroup = peer {
fieldKeys.append(.title)
if canEditPeerInfo(context: self.context, peer: peer, chatLocation: chatLocation, threadData: threadData) {
fieldKeys.append(.description)
}
} else if case .channel = peer {
fieldKeys.append(.title)
if canEditPeerInfo(context: self.context, peer: peer, chatLocation: chatLocation, threadData: threadData) {
fieldKeys.append(.description)
}
}
var hasPrevious = false
for key in fieldKeys {
let itemNode: PeerInfoHeaderTextFieldNode
var updateText: String?
if let current = self.itemNodes[key] {
itemNode = current
} else {
var isMultiline = false
switch key {
case .firstName:
if case let .user(user) = peer {
if let editableBotInfo = (cachedData as? CachedUserData)?.editableBotInfo {
updateText = editableBotInfo.name
} else {
updateText = user.firstName ?? ""
}
}
case .lastName:
if case let .user(user) = peer {
updateText = user.lastName ?? ""
} else {
updateText = ""
}
case .title:
updateText = peer?.debugDisplayTitle ?? ""
case .description:
isMultiline = true
if let cachedData = cachedData as? CachedChannelData {
updateText = cachedData.about ?? ""
} else if let cachedData = cachedData as? CachedGroupData {
updateText = cachedData.about ?? ""
} else if let cachedData = cachedData as? CachedUserData {
if let editableBotInfo = cachedData.editableBotInfo {
updateText = editableBotInfo.about
} else {
updateText = cachedData.about ?? ""
}
} else {
updateText = ""
}
}
if isMultiline {
itemNode = PeerInfoHeaderMultiLineTextFieldNode(requestUpdateHeight: { [weak self] in
self?.requestUpdateLayout()
})
} else {
itemNode = PeerInfoHeaderSingleLineTextFieldNode()
}
self.itemNodes[key] = itemNode
self.addSubnode(itemNode)
}
let placeholder: String
var isEnabled = true
switch key {
case .firstName:
placeholder = isEditableBot ? presentationData.strings.UserInfo_BotNamePlaceholder : presentationData.strings.UserInfo_FirstNamePlaceholder
isEnabled = isContact || isSettings || isEditableBot
case .lastName:
placeholder = presentationData.strings.UserInfo_LastNamePlaceholder
isEnabled = isContact || isSettings
case .title:
if case let .channel(channel) = peer, case .broadcast = channel.info {
placeholder = presentationData.strings.GroupInfo_ChannelListNamePlaceholder
} else {
placeholder = presentationData.strings.GroupInfo_GroupNamePlaceholder
}
isEnabled = canEditPeerInfo(context: self.context, peer: peer, chatLocation: chatLocation, threadData: threadData)
case .description:
placeholder = presentationData.strings.Channel_Edit_AboutItem
isEnabled = canEditPeerInfo(context: self.context, peer: peer, chatLocation: chatLocation, threadData: threadData) || isEditableBot
}
let itemHeight = itemNode.update(width: width, safeInset: safeInset, isSettings: isSettings, hasPrevious: hasPrevious, hasNext: key != fieldKeys.last, placeholder: placeholder, isEnabled: isEnabled, presentationData: presentationData, updateText: updateText)
transition.updateFrame(node: itemNode, frame: CGRect(origin: CGPoint(x: 0.0, y: contentHeight), size: CGSize(width: width, height: itemHeight)))
contentHeight += itemHeight
hasPrevious = true
}
var removeKeys: [PeerInfoHeaderTextFieldNodeKey] = []
for (key, _) in self.itemNodes {
if !fieldKeys.contains(key) {
removeKeys.append(key)
}
}
for key in removeKeys {
if let itemNode = self.itemNodes.removeValue(forKey: key) {
itemNode.removeFromSupernode()
}
}
return contentHeight
}
}
